Description

The Mega Slow is a large and tanky enemy which only appears on Hardcore mode. While it has below average speed, it has very high health for its debut. This makes it a very dangerous threat. Additionally, it has 15% defense, reducing the effectiveness of most towers. It also has energy immunity, meaning that it cannot be stopped by the Electroshocker or Warden.

The Mega Slow can be spawned by the Void Reaver and Grave Digger, in Hardcore mode only. The Mystery Boss can also spawn the Mega Slow upon its death in Hardcore mode.

Appearance

The first and current Mega Slow is shorter than the Giant Boss. It has a reflective green skin and is faceless. It has tumors on its left arm and on its head. Its torso, sleeves and legs are granite black. It also has a metal armband on its right arm and growing hooks on both of its shoulders. It also has a small black axe stabbed into its back. It walks slightly hunchbacked and has a twisted left leg.

The second Mega Slow was similar to its current version except it had only one hook on its shoulder.

Strategy

  • Because of the Mega Slow's early appearance and the increased prices of towers and upgrades in Hardcore mode, it may be the downfall of most players if they are unprepared for it.
    • For this reason, Farms are heavily recommended so that you will be able to afford more expensive upgrades sooner.
    • Additionally, if you got a lot of Lead Bosses from Mysteries on previous waves, the Mega Slow's debut can easily lead to a defeat.
  • High DPS towers, such as the Level 3 Accelerator, or Ranger are recommended against this.
    • The Minigunner and Golden Minigunner can also be used, however as they do not have lead penetration, they cannot deal with the Lead Bosses that spawn before the Mega Slow.
    • If you are using the Ranger to defeat the Mega Slow, it is recommended to set its targetting to Strongest so that it can damage the Mega Slow instead of weaker enemies, wasting its shots.
  • The Military Base's Tanks and Humvee 3s can be effective against this enemy, as they deal full collision damage to defense enemies. Once the Mega Slow begins to spawn in large hordes, however, their effectiveness is reduced.
    • Early on, multiple Humvee 2s is the best way to take down the Mega Slow due to their cheap price, even with the Hardcore mode's 50% price increase. Additionally, most maps for Hardcore are pretty long, giving the Humvee 2s more time to spawn and damage this enemy.
  • A Level 4 Golden Scout can easily take down the Mega Slow for a relatively cheap price.
  • You can use slowing towers, such as the Toxic Gunner, Electroshocker or Sledger to slow this down.

Trivia

  • The appearance of the Mega Slow is similar to the old design of Boss4 from Tower Battles.
  • Weirdly, the health of the Mega Slow was increased in MEGA Servers, despite it not being able to spawn in a MEGA Server without admin commands.
  • When the Mega Slow was frozen by the Sledger prior to the 23rd of March 2022, it had a chance to create a huge wall of ice.
